My boys started day camp last week, and my friends were all visiting their older children at sleep away camp this past weekend and it got me nostalgic for summer camp. Personally, I loved camp. I went to girl scout camp and YMCA camp until I was 16. Such fun memories.


(via flickr)

I could be anyone I wanted because I never went to camp with my friends. My mother would just hear about some camp and sign me up. It was scary, but freeing at the same time. I even had my first slow dance at camp. I don't remember his name, but I remembered he was wearing cologne (um hello, we were like 14! What is up with the cologne?) and he smelled soooo good. To this day I love it when men smell like cologne.

(via flickr)

My favorite things to do were sing, make lanyards, craft time, hiking, and campfires. I swear I started hundreds of lanyards and never completed a single one. And then after we graduated from lanyards we learned to make friendship bracelets. You KNOW you made them, traded them, and loved them.
